Well having driven XR8s on various test drives (yes, I did think about getting one myself) it just didn't have the pace of the XR6T, plus it felt (obviously) heavier in the front end, which caused a bit of front end push.

I am just stating my opinon and what I experienced. I just find it hard to justify paying more for something that is slower, thirstier and doesn't handle as well as the XR6T. It is just my preference for handling over straight line speed that made me pick the T. If I wanted a cruiser I would get the XR8, simple as that.

I suggest you take both cars for a drive anyway, its a pretty stupid statement saying you don't even need to drive another model of car.. It's like buying the first house you ever look at.
